(2) Cookies

Our website uses cookies. 

 

(a) Cookies are small text files placed on your machine to help the site provide a better user experience. Cookies are used to retain user preferences, store information for things like shopping baskets, and provide anonymised tracking data to third-party applications like Google Analytics. As a rule, cookies will make your browsing experience better.

You can turn off cookies on this site. 

See www.aboutcookies.org
